Position Summary

This position is responsible for providing speech-language pathology services to a pediatric population, from neonate to adolescent, including evaluation and treatment in the areas of communication and swallowing.

Position Duties

  • Evaluates and treats patients with communication and swallowing disorders/delays, demonstrating knowledge of normal growth and skills necessary to provide age appropriate services. Uses pediatric based behavior management strategies and matches diagnostic/therapeutic interventions to age and disability of the child. Establishes appropriate treatment plan with age‑appropriate goals and target timeframes, which are discussed with family and mutually agreed upon
  • Maintains appropriate documentation per the Policies & Procedures Manual in compliance with JCAHO and CARF standards, including participation in Total Quality Management.
  • Builds and maintains rapport within the department, hospital, and community, professionally interacting with physician, families, and hospital/community personnel.
  • Evaluates recommended needs for equipment and supplies.
  • Assists in the monitoring of speech pathology students.
  • Performs miscellaneous job related duties as requested.
